随着5G网络的全面商用和持续发展,这一领域已成为技术创新的前沿阵地。程序员作为技术开发的核心力量,如何在5G网络科技领域内实现技术破局,不仅关乎个人职业发展,也影响着整个产业的进步。以下从技术学习、实践应用和创新思维三个层面,探讨程序员在5G领域实现突破的路径。
一、深耕核心技术,构建专业知识体系
5G技术涉及多个层面,程序员需系统学习其核心技术。应掌握5G的三大应用场景:增强移动宽带(eMBB)、超高可靠低时延通信(uRLLC)和海量机器类通信(mMTC)。深入理解5G关键技术,如毫米波通信、大规模天线阵列(Massive MIMO)、网络切片、边缘计算等。还需熟悉相关协议和标准,如3GPP Release 15及后续版本。建议通过在线课程、技术文档和实践项目,逐步构建完整的5G知识体系,并关注6G等前沿动向,保持技术敏感度。
二、聚焦应用场景,参与实际项目开发
理论需与实践结合。程序员应积极参与5G相关项目,将技术知识转化为实际解决方案。例如,在物联网(IoT)领域,开发基于5G的低功耗广域网应用;在工业互联网中,实现高可靠性的远程控制系統;在增强现实(AR)/虚拟现实(VR)领域,利用5G的高带宽和低延迟优化用户体验。通过实际开发,程序员不仅能加深对5G技术的理解,还能积累解决复杂问题的经验。参与开源项目或行业合作,有助于拓宽视野并建立技术影响力。
三、培养创新思维,探索跨界融合机会
5G的突破往往来自跨领域融合。程序员需培养创新思维,探索5G与其他技术的结合点。例如,将5G与人工智能(AI)结合,开发智能网络管理系統;利用5G赋能自动驾驶,实现车联网(V2X)通信;或将区块链技术与5G网络整合,提升数据安全性。关注垂直行业需求,如医疗、教育、农业等,寻找5G技术的落地场景,开发定制化解决方案。通过跨界思考,程序员可以开辟新的技术方向,实现从跟随者到创新者的转变。
四、加强软技能,适应快速变化的环境
5G领域技术更新迅速,程序员需具备快速学习能力和适应性。除了硬技能,软技能同样重要。例如,加强团队协作,因为5G项目通常涉及多方合作;提升沟通能力,以清晰表达技术方案;培养项目管理意识,确保开发效率。保持好奇心和探索精神,主动追踪行业动态,参加技术社区和会议,与同行交流心得,这将有助于在快速变化的5G生态中找到自己的定位。
程序员在5G网络科技领域的破局之路,需要技术深度与实践广度并重,同时以创新思维驱动跨界探索。通过持续学习、积极参与和开放合作,程序员不仅能提升自身竞争力,还能为5G技术的发展贡献关键力量,最终在这个充满机遇的领域中实现个人与行业的共同突破。
如若转载,请注明出处:http://www.muzhitaojin.com/product/56.html
更新时间:2026-01-15 20:47:50